WalletHub Ranks Small Cities, From Best to Worst

Nov. 5, 2015

Residents of Princeton, N.J., enjoy idyllic, small town life, according to a study on the best and worst small cities in the U.S. by WalletHub.

The small college town, home to the prestigious Princeton University, ranks first place in economic health, number seven for education and health, and number 41 in quality of life. The town didn’t fare well with affordability, though, ranking at number 1,144 out of the 1,268 small cities compared.

The 20 worst small cities in the country were all in California, and included the towns of Compton, Hawthorne, Perris, and at the bottom of the list, Bell.
